What is Local Fintech and Why Does it Matter for Albany?
Local fintech refers to financial technology solutions tailored for a specific geographic area. For Albany, this means platforms and services that understand the local market, support local businesses, and cater to the financial habits of its residents.
It matters because it keeps capital circulating within the community. When you use a local fintech service, you’re often supporting local jobs and innovation. This creates a stronger, more resilient economic ecosystem for everyone in Albany.

3. Evaluate and Choose Your Tools
Once you’ve identified potential providers, it’s time to evaluate them. Consider factors beyond just features.
* **Security:** How is your data protected? Look for robust security measures.
* **User Experience:** Is the platform intuitive and easy to use?
* **Fees and Costs:** Understand the pricing structure clearly.
* **Customer Support:** Is local support available if you need it?
* **Community Impact:** Does the provider invest back into the Albany community?
For small businesses, consider integrations with existing systems. For individuals, think about how it fits into your daily financial routine.

Enhancing Financial Inclusion
Fintech can bridge gaps in financial access. For residents who may be unbanked or underbanked, digital platforms offer new ways to manage money, build credit, and access financial services.
Mobile banking apps and digital wallets are making financial participation easier. This is particularly important in ensuring all members of the Albany community can benefit from economic growth.
